4 Thoroughly shake the cartridge 5 or 6 times to distribute the toner
evenly inside the cartridge. Doing so will help ensure maximum
copies per cartridge.
5 Remove the paper protecting the print cartridge by pulling the
packing tape.
6 Hold the print cartridge by the handle and slowly insert the cartridge
into the opening in the printer.
Note
Refer to the helpful pictures on the cartridge wrapping paper.
Caution
If toner gets on your clothing, wipe it off with a dry cloth and
wash clothing in cold water. Hot water sets toner into fabric.
To prevent damage to the print cartridge, do not expose it to
light for more than a few minutes. Cover it with a piece of
paper, if necessary.
Do not touch the green surface underside of the print cartridge.
Use the handle on the cartridge to avoid touching this area.
3250-034
3250-036
Tabs on the sides of the cartridge and corresponding grooves
within the printer will guide the cartridge into the correct position
until it locks into place completely.
7 Close the front cover. Make sure that the cover is securely closed.
Printing a configuration page
You can print a configuration page to view current printer settings, or to
help troubleshoot printer problems.
Press and hold the Start/Stop button for about 5 seconds.
A configuration page prints out.
Maintenance parts
To avoid print quality and paper feed problems resulting from worn parts
and to maintain your machine in top working condition the following
items will need to be replaced at the specified number of pages or when
the life span of each item has expired.
Xerox
highly recommends that an authorized service provider, dealer or the
retailer where you bought printer performs this maintenance activity. The
warranty does not cover the replacement of the maintenance parts after their
lifespan.
Items Yield (Average)
Transfer roller Approx. 50,000 pages
Fuser unit Approx. 50,000 pages
Pick-up roller Approx. 50,000 pages
